Kevin was recently asked by the People's Republic of South Devon to answer their Quick Candidates Quiz, he copies his answers below:
What's your background?
Born in Plymouth, My Father was a Painter\Labourer in Devonport Dockyard and my Mother was a Teaching Assistant. Studied Law at Warwick University and worked a range of jobs from van driver, food factory operative and barman to help fund my studies. I spent 12 years as a Councillor in the Midlands before returning to Devon. I am now living in Abbey Road, Torquay and am a member of the Steering Group of the Torquay Town Centre Community Partnership.
What got you into politics?
I have always had an interest in current affairs and how politics makes a difference to people’s daily lives. I therefore felt drawn to get involved myself as I dislike those who just stand on the side-lines and complain or say they could do better, yet do nothing more than that.
Why are you in the party you're in (or not in, if you're an independent)?
As a believer in free enterprise, people enjoying the fruits of their own labour and promoting aspiration, the Conservative Party was the natural choice. This is despite my family background (Dad has been a member of Unite for over 40 years) more indicating a preference to Labour, although during the Blair years they seemed not very far from where I am politically.
UKIP does not appeal at all and I have always seen the Liberal Democrats as nothing more than a political version of a franchise operation, pretending to be left wing in some seats right wing in others depending on who they are talking to.
Why do you want to be elected?
The bay faces a range of challenges from too many not earning a living wage, to more people on unemployment benefit in Torquay and Paignton than our two neighbouring constituencies combined. A fresh approach, based on a clear plan of action for our bay, our region and our nation is what I want to deliver if successful.
And why you - what's your own political 'USP' (unique selling point/proposition)?
I am a blue collar Conservative whose family worked hard to buy their own home and put me through university. This gives me the drive to help others achieve their aspirations and has driven my positive campaign to make a difference, not just base my offer on scare stories about my opponents.
